Depends on the individual. Same applies with any of the Centropyge sp.

Most at risk will be clams or fleshy corals like Trachyphyilla or Scolymia, whose flesh resembles clam mantles.

Usually they don't bother SPS - but again, the fish don't read the textbooks ;)

I had a Coral Beauty once that left everything alone except for Xenia - it mowed the stuff down like there was no tomorrow. Some may consider that a good thing.

It's always a calculated risk.
